Trump’s Trade War Ignites Chaos: Crypto Crashes, Markets Tumble!

In a move that has sent shockwaves through global markets, President Donald Trump has enacted substantial tariffs on imports from Canada, Mexico, and China, citing national security concerns over illegal immigration and drug trafficking.

The executive order, signed on February 1, 2025, imposes a 25% tariff on all Mexican and Canadian products entering the U.S., with a 10% tariff applied to Chinese goods. Notably, Canadian energy imports, including oil, are subject to a reduced 10% tariff to mitigate potential impacts on fuel prices, given that approximately 60% of U.S. imported oil originates from Canada.

Immediate Market Reactions

The announcement triggered a swift and severe response across financial markets. Global equity markets tumbled, with significant declines in Asian and European indices. U.S. stock futures also pointed to a sharp downturn, signaling a turbulent opening for Wall Street. The U.S. dollar surged against a basket of currencies, while the Canadian dollar and Mexican peso plummeted.

Cryptocurrency Market Turmoil

The cryptocurrency market was not spared from the upheaval. Bitcoin, the leading digital asset, plunged below the $100,000 mark, reaching a three-week low of $91,441.89. Ether, the second-largest cryptocurrency, dropped to $2,494.33, its lowest level since early September. Investors, spooked by the escalating trade tensions, fled from riskier assets, leading to a massive sell-off in the crypto space.

Robert Kiyosaki, renowned author of “Rich Dad Poor Dad,” commented on the downturn, stating,

“This is a time of great opportunity. Assets are on sale. Savvy investors will seize this moment.”

Global Trade Tensions Escalate

In response to the U.S. tariffs, Canada and Mexico announced retaliatory measures. Canadian Prime Minister Justin Trudeau declared plans to impose 25% tariffs on C$155 billion worth of American goods, effective February 4, 2025, urging Canadians to support domestic products. Mexican President Claudia Sheinbaum indicated that Mexico would implement measured retaliatory steps, emphasizing that the Mexican government does not collaborate with drug traffickers.

China, on the other hand, vowed to challenge the U.S. tariffs at the World Trade Organization, setting the stage for a protracted legal battle. The escalating tensions have raised concerns about a full-blown trade war, with potential repercussions for global economic growth and stability.

Investor Sentiment and Economic Outlook

Economists warn that these tariffs could lead to increased consumer prices in the U.S., potential inflation, and disruptions in global trade. The U.S. Federal Reserve may face challenges in implementing planned interest rate cuts due to anticipated inflationary pressures resulting from the tariffs.

Financial markets have reacted negatively, with significant declines observed globally. U.S. stock futures dropped sharply, and oil prices rose, signaling potential economic disruptions. The U.S. dollar strengthened against other currencies, which could increase costs for American exporters.

President Trump remains steadfast in his decision, asserting that foreign entities, including China influence critics of the tariffs. He emphasized the necessity of these measures to protect American interests and address trade imbalances.

Glossary of Key Terms

  • Tariff: A tax imposed by a government on imported or exported goods.
  • Cryptocurrency: A digital or virtual currency that uses cryptography for security and operates independently of a central bank.
  • Bitcoin: The first and most well-known cryptocurrency, often referred to as digital gold.
  • Ether: The cryptocurrency of the Ethereum network, used to facilitate transactions and computational services.
  • Trade War: A situation where countries impose tariffs or other trade barriers against each other in response to trade disputes.
  • Inflation: The rate at which the general level of prices for goods and services rises, eroding purchasing power.
  • Retaliatory Tariffs: Tariffs imposed by a country in response to similar measures taken against it by another country.
  • World Trade Organization (WTO): An international organization that regulates trade between nations.
